Где-нибудь нужно определить функцию:
function menuOrderCompare($a, $b) {
if ( $a->menu_order === $b->menu_order) { return 0; }
return ( $a->menu_order < $b->menu_order) ? -1 : 1;
}
Далее после получения массива контента, изображений или постов сортируем их.
usort($customPageQuery, "menuOrderCompare");
Для того чтобы получить данные bloginfo не выплевывая сразу полученное содержимое следует использовать немного другую функцию.
get_bloginfo();
Как правильно подключать wp_pagenavi
<?php
if(function_exists(’wp_pagenavi’)) wp_pagenavi();
?>
Нужно всего лишь добавить в файл functions.php
add_post_type_support("page", "excerpt");
При doctype strict, под изображениями появляются дополнительные паддинги, убрать их можно просто задав img { vertical-align:bottom;}
<?php cat_is_ancestor_of( $cat1, $cat2 ); ?>
Принимает 2 параметра.
Параметр первый айди родительской категории.
Параметр второй айди дитенка.
Заказал диск здесь.
Пришел довольно быстро, хотя там написано 5-6 недель. Давно хотел начать работать в Linux. Потому-что
Linux это open source, нет тебе здесь никаких активаций, кейгенов и другого мусора. Сначала я поставил 9 версию, я мало с ней провозился и она мне непонравилась. Но когда мне пришел красивенький диск с 10 решил поставить, а потом [...]
Это кусок кода, который выводит рандомный пост из некоторой категории.
<?php
$catID = 5;
$customPostQuery = new WP_query();
$customPosts = $customPostQuery->query("cat=$catID");
if ($customPosts) : while ($customPosts = $customPostQuery->have_posts()) : $customPosts = $customPostQuery->the_post(); ?>
<?php
$wordings[] = $post->ID;
?>
<?php endwhile; endif;
if(isset($wordings)&&$wordings) {
$c = count($wordings)-1;
$r = $wordings[rand(0, $c)];
$pq = new [...]
24.05.10 / Категории PHP | 1 Комментарий
int rand ( int $min , int $max );
Принимает 2 параметра.
1 минимальное значение
2 максимальное значение